Myocardial protection by oxygenated crystalloid cardioplegia was studied in isolated working rat hearts. After normothermic and hypothermic ischemia, recovery of aortic output was good in rat hearts that were infused with oxygenated crystalloid cardioplegic solution. Under hypothermic ischemia by topical cooling, recovery of aortic output from low oxygenated crystalloid cardioplegia was not good after reperfusion. It was concluded that oxygenated crystalloid cardioplegia is well able to protect the myocardium even under hypothermia, because aerobic metabolism might be maintained in the hypothermic myocardium.

To evaluate the effect of myocardial protection by oxygenated crystalloid cardioplegia, we investigated the recovery of cardiac function from the beginning of coronary reperfusion to the early postsurgical period after mitral valve replacement. Ten patients were set ected for this study excluding patients who had accompanying aortic valve disease or severe coronary artery disease. Five patients received oxygenated St. Thomas' Hospital solution and five recieved non-oxygenated St. Thomas' Hospital solution. At the beginning of reperfusion, hearts infused with the oxygenated crystalloid cardioplegic solution showed the good recovery of cardiac function, such as time to start the cardiac beat, the need of electric defibrillation, or pacemaker. The clinical evaluation could not be cleared but the five patients who received myocardial protection by using oxygenated cardioplegia showed higher cardiac index than the patients who received non-oxygenated cardioplegia.

The changes and prediction of the prevalence rate of diabetes mellitus (DM), and the percentage of DM patients receiving therapy (rate of treated patients) during the remaining years until 2000 AD were obtained by exponential regression analysis on the basis of various data accumulated during the most recent 10 or more years. As a result, assuming that recent trends would continue, the DM prevalence rate and rate of treated DM patients were estimated to increase at a considerably faster rate than the corresponding increase rates of all diseases as a function of age-group, the expected rate of increase is especially large 'n the age group over 64 years. It was estimated that in the year 2000 the DM prevalence rate will be 4 times and the rate of treated DM patients will be 2 times their 1985 rates. In the study of formulizing estimation of the prefectural prevalence rate of DM, using Patient Survey results, a new method of estimation of the prevalence rate of DM was developed in which the number of total illnesses was considered. This method was found to be valid. Next, the results of health examination (the DM-positive rate, the urinary glucose-positive rate, the receiving rate) performed in accordance with the Health and Medical Services Law for the Aged and the DM prevalence rate calculated from the Patient Survey were subjected to correlation analyses. The analyses revealed a positive correlation between the positive rates of these parameters and the DM prevalence rate.

Image contrast defined by the count density of nuclear medicine image is often used to evaluate abnormal accumulation of radioisotope (RI) due to disease. However, the image is not always a true radioactivity distribution of the patient, because of the presence of many factors that degrade the image quality. These are inadequate resolution of the scintillation camera, and absorption and scatter of γ-rays. Therefore, it is important to examine how well the image reflects the object radioactivity distribution. In the present paper, the relation between object contrast, defind by RI distribution, and image contrast, difined by count density, was investigated experimentally. The phantom 1 consists of a cube with low background activity and a sphere or circular disk with high activity. Phantom 2 (cold case) consists of a cube with high activity and a sphere without RI activity. These phamtoms were imaged with a scintillation camera and the image contrast (count density of the sphere or disk/background count density) was calculated. Correlation between the object contrast and image contrast was linear, supporting its use to evalute the abnormal accumulation of RI in a patient. However, on account of the effect of scatter, the absolute value of image contrast was somewhat smaller than the object contrast. It should then be important, considering above results, to use the image contrast in clinical study.

The cross sectional areas of the trunk musculature observed in CT images at the level of E5 of Erdheim's grid (corresponding to the level of the mid-point of the sternum) were analyzed to elucidate its development and functional significance
in situ. The subjects included 99 healthy adults (50 males, 49 females), whose ages ranged from the thirties to the seventies. The shape of the cross section of each muscle was traced on a CT image and the cross sectional area (CSA) was then measured. The data were analyzed against sex, laterality, age and body type. Results. 1. The CSAs of the scapular muscles and the m. latissimus dorsi tended to be larger in males than in females, and in the right than in the left. This suggests that differences in the medial rotation of the upper arm are related to sex and laterality. The CSAs of the m. serratus anterior, m. trapezius and m. rhomboideus, which appeared in fixation of the scapula, tended to be larger in males than in females. 2. The CSAs of the proper back muscles at the level of the mid-point of the sternum were 1/3 those in the lumbar region in males and 1/4 in females. The E5 level proper back muscles were observed to decrease with age of the male earlier than those of the lumbar back muscles. 3. The CSAs of the seventies age group were smallest. Decrease with aging was observed in muscles with phasic function. These tendencies suggested that decrease by aging would appear with the phasic function of the shoulder girdle. 4. Relation between body type and each muscle were also investigated. The CSAs of m. serratus anterior, m, trapezius and m. latissimus dorsi decreased in the order of the D, C and A body type. The CSAs of the m, teres major and m. subscapularis of the D body type tended to be larger than those of other types. These thus correlated with the demand for trunk support functions of the upper limbs because of obesity.

We measured time related changes of lung functions, plasma substance P, histamine and leucotriene C
4 (LTC
4) in 18 asthmatic patients and 5 normal subjects following inhalation of ultrasonically nebulized distilled water (USNDWI) and of isotonic (0.9 %) saline to clarify the mechanism of bronchial response after USNDWI. None of the subjects investigated had obvious changes in pulmonary functions due to the isotonic saline. However, while normal subjects had no apparent change after USNDWI, among the asthmatic patients, 9 had an immediate bronchial response (JAR alone group), 5 had immediate and late bronchial responses (dual AR group), and 4 had no brochial response (nonresponder group) . In the dual AR group, plasma substance P tended to increase in JAR and LAR, and plasma histamine and LTC
4 tended to increase in JAR. The results suggest that the mechanism of JAR after USNDWI may be due to provocation of a chemical mediator release from mast cells through axonal reflex, and that the development of LAR itself after USNDWI revealed relations between these mechanisms and mast cells.

The shape and myofibrous organization of the tensor fasciae latae muscle was investigated quantitatively to elucidate functional characteristics of the muscular morphology. The present data were compared with data accumulated in our laboratory. Right tensor fasciae latae muscles were obtained from 27 cadavers for dissecting practice (18 males, 9 females, mean age 68.6 yrs) . After the length, width and thickness of the muscle were measured, H.E. stained preparations were made for measurement of the muscle fiber. Results : 1. The muscle masses and volumes were larger in male than in female. Trends of change due to aging were observed. These trends were remarkable in both males and females older than 60. Cross sectional areas of the muscle belly in the oldest group were also very small. 2. The mean number of the muscle fibers in a unit area (1 mm
2) was greater in females (1176) than in males (1012) . These values were smaller than those of the psoas major muscle, and similar to those of the iliacus muscle, but were larger than those of the quadratus lumborum muscle. 3. The mean numbers of total muscle fibers per muscle were 188112 in males and 170531 in females. Trends of change due to aging were observed in males. The trend in males was similar to those of the quadratus lumborum and iliacus muscles, but less than that of the psoas major muscle. The trend in females was similar to that of the psoas major muscle, but less than that of the quadratus lumborum muscle. 4. The mean cross sectional areas of the muscle fibers were 802 μm
2 in males and 632 μm
2 in females. Derease of thickness due to aging was observed in males. These values were similar to those of the psoas major muscle in both sexes, but smaller than those of the quadratus lumborum and iliacus muscles. 5. The mean density of muscle fiber was larger in males (74.5 %) than in females (65.8 %) . These values were similar to those of the psoas major and quadratus lumborum muscles in both males and females.

—CILIUM MOVEMENT AND SCANNING ELECTRON MICROSCOPIC STUDIES OF THE SEXUAL CYCLE, PREGNANCY, POSTPARTUM AND CASTRATION—

To study the form and functions of the fallopian tubes, ciliary movement was investigated, and scanning electron microscope views during the sexual cycle, pregnancy, postpartum, after castration, and after administration of sexual steroid hormones were examin-ed. 1) Cliliary movement was frequent during proestrus, metestrus, and diestrus, but infrequent during estrus. The form of the ciliated cells did not change. Secretory cells were markedly distended in metestrus, suggesting the effects of estrogen and progesterone. 2) Ciliary movement increased on the 1st day of pregnancy, but decreased on the 2nd and the 3rd days and increased again from the 4th day on. The form of the ciliated cells did not change during pregnancy. Secretory cells were active in the 2nd day and, in cooperation with the decreased ciliary movement, controlled the transport of fertilized ova. Epithelial cells were exhausted by the 20th day of pregnancy, and on the 1st postpartum day the epithelia were devastated. However, both ciliated cells and secretory cells had regenerated by the 5th postpartum day. 3) Three weeks after castration, ciliated cells in the fallopian tubes were short and did not move briskly. The surfaces of the secretory cells were exfoliated, and the microvilli disappeared. Administration of estradiol caused both ciliated cells and secretory cells to regenerate well. Administration of progesterone increased secretory cells, but they appeared wasted.

Changes in serum free-thyroid hormones after administration of thyroid hormone preparations were studied in 48 patients with primary hypothyroidism. When
l-thyroxine (
l-T
4) was given orally or intravenously, a slight increase was observed in the concentration of serum FT
4, but no significant change was found in the concentration of serum T
3, or FT
3, unless the dose of
l-T
4 exceeded 150 μg. The concentrations of serum T
3 and FT
3 were quickly increased to super normal levels by even a relatively small dose of
l-triiodothyronine (
l-T
3) . When more than 50 mg of dessicated thyroid was given orally, the concentrations of serum T
3 and FT
3 exceeded the normal upper limit. These result indicate that the best and safest medicament among the thyroid hormone preparations for the treatment of hypothyroidism is
l-thyroxine, either oral or intravenous.

A patient's computer for medical information should contain information aimed at effectively managing all data in the patients database. However, it is not cost effective to line up each instrument to scan the various medical data in different media simultaneos-ly, and even if instruments are connected, it requires too much time to scan each data image, CT, Echo, MRI, Endoscope, etc. We have introduced a computer-compatible still video medical image capturing system to resolve these problems. The new system consists of a still video camera and a personal computer with a full-color, video digitizer board and a 32 bit CPU. The still video camera can take a 1/15 to 30 second exposure that is controlled as an NTSC signal, and the image data is highly compatible to these machines. The still video system controls the taking of medical images and the computer controls the capture of image from the vide system. Introduction of the still video system releases us from these problems. There are also other advantages : This system can be used for preoperative conferences, to illustrate explanations for the patient's family after a surgical operation, and to lecture to medical students. The system is also able to capture micro findings on a plate through a CC D camera attached to a microscope and manage these image data captured by the computer as an image database.

We introduce here three kinds of reconstruction post anterior resection for patients with rectal cancer using an auto stapler machine. PCEEA (Premium Curved EEA Stapler) an improved EEA Stapler has several functions : Two-part shaft assembly, removable trocar, cartridge shield trocar, and others. These new functions allow us to reconstruct the intestinal tracts of patients with rectal cancer in the following ways without colostomy :
1) End to end anastomosis ;
2) End to side anastomosis ;
3) Double Stapling.
Adoption of a technique depends on the anastomotic level. Double stapling is adopt at the lower level of the technique. Leakage for these technques : Two of 13 cases of end to end anastomosis, three of 9 cases of double stapling, and no case of side to end anastomosis. We concluded that although leakage rate is highest the double stapling method, leakage is also caused by other factors such as blood flow to the retained rectum, fragility of the wall, tension at the anastomosis, and other reasons.

Although there may be no clinical signs of tumors in patients with cob-rectal cancer, intestinal contents are sometimes blocked on the oral side of the tumor. This could lead to the following consequences during prepreparation of patients with cob-rectal cancer : intestinal flora may be reduced to 0.1-0.001 that in appear patients without cancer, and cancer cells from the tumor may appear in the content. We have found class N positive in 40 % of cytology in irrigation water after washing out the colonal lumen. We have engaged ED or IVH, for one week with no chemical or mechanical preparation of patients with colon cancer, but intestinal contents remained in 20 % of the patients. These contents can sometimes cause postoperative complications. There are two methods of decompression before and during surgical operation for colon cancer, with and without stenosis. One method is rectal prothesis ; a prosthetic instrument placed at the stenosis of the rectum with irrigation through the lumen of the instrument. Irrigation is possible in the whole colon for 3 to 4 days, after which a barium enema is possible to get information from the oral side of stenosis. Another method is irrigation of the whole colon from the oral stump after removing the tumor. As a result of either method of irrigation, remarkably fine operative maneuvers are possible, and we have seen no post operative comoplications. By using either of the two methods, the incidence of anastomotic leakage has been diminished compared operations without irrigation or rectal prosthesis. Thus, for preoprative patients with stenotic rectal cancer, a rectal prosthesis developed us has greatly improved prognosis.

Changes in the numbers of operative cases in the central operating room of Showa University Hospital from 1987 to 1989 were studied. The total number of operations remained constant, but the number controlled by anesthesiologists increased. Emergency cases tended to be fewer. By age, fewer infants and more aged people received anesthesia. Operations using systemic anesthesia exceeding 4 hours increased. More cases per month, in all departments, received anesthesia in July, March and August, and fewer received anesthesia in January, February and November. Especially, large increases in numbers of cases were noted in operations on patients 6 to 16 years old. Moreover, increases in the Department of Otolaryngology and Department of Plastic Surgery were large, while increases in the Department of Surgery and Department of Orthopedic Surgery were smaller.

In recent years, it is often stated that preoperative evaluation of the mediastinum should be by imaging techniques such as computed tomographic scanning (CT scan) and magnetic resonance imaging (MRI) which offer high resolution. These are, however, indirect diagnostic techniques for assessing the presence of metastasis to mediastinal lymph nodes. Mediastinoscopy was first described in 1959 by Carlens. We introduced this method of preoperative diagnosis by mediastinoscopy to the selection for operation of patients with lung cancer and other diseases. In the present paper, we discuss three cases with mediastinal disease, two patients with lung cancer and one with esophageal duplication cyst. We conclude that mediastinoscopy with imaging techniques, such as CT scanning and MRI-CT should be obligatory for preoperative evaluation of patients with lung cancer, among other diseases, in whom there is the slightest suspicion of metastasis to mediastinal lymph nodes.

We report here, two cases of cecal cancer with appendicitis-like symptoms.
Case one was a 75 year old male. He complained of ileocecal pain with high fever for two days, and his WBC was 21200/mm
3. The diagnosis was acute appendicitis. He refused an appendectomy, so he was given chemotherapy for 3 days and his symptoms completely disappeared. Later, a barium enema, as part of a thorough exmamination before his discharge, revealed a focal cancer of the cecum. The cancer was removed by ileocecal resection. In this case there was no pathological connection between the cecal cancer and acute appendicitis.
Case two was a 78 year old male. The diagnosis was acute appendicitis, and appendectomy was performed. During the operation a tumor was found near the formis appendix. Biopsy indicated pathological adenocarcinoma. Two weeks later, the tumor was removed surgically.
When a patient complains of acute appendicitis-like symptoms, the following possibilities must also be considered : 1) acute appendicitis due to obstruction of the lumen by a tumor ; 2) acute appendicitis and cecal cancer at the same time ; and 3) cancer may be causing the appendicitis-like symptoms.

A case of hepatocellular carcinoma with Otsu-type liver cirrhosis is reported. A 61 years old man was admitted our hospital with complaints of general fatigue and weight loss. He had a blood transfusion 31 years ago. Laboratory data showed elevation of hepato-bile enzyme and abdominal CT, US, angiography revealed evidence of hepatocellular carcinoma. Antithrombim III (AT-III) level was high from first admission and increased to 84.62 mg/dl. He died of hepatic failure, but the AT-III level did not decrease. At autopsy, the liver weighed 4340 g. The surface of the liver was rough, and cut surfaces showed diffuse nodules of hepatocelluar carcinoma. Microscopically, tumor cells were trabecular and pseudoglandular type with Edmondson grade III atypism. Immunohistologically, the tumor cells showed positivity against anti AT-III antibody. This case suggests the potential of AT-III synthesis of hepatocellular carcinoma.

We encountered an esophageal cancer (mp) with a marked cauliflower like tumor. A 69-year-old female was admitted to our associated hospital with complaints of heartburn and anterior chest pain. An upper GI series revealed a huge filling defect, 9.5cm in the major axis, in the middle esophagus. Endoscopic findings showed profuse bleading on the surface of the tumor. Biopsy findings from the polypoid lesion indicated well differentiated squamous cell carcinoma. Histological examination of a resected specimen, 8.0×5.0 cm showed that cancer invasion was limited to the mucosa in the major part of the cauliflower like tumor, and to sm and mp only in a small part of the base of the tumor. No vessel invasion or lymph node metastasis were observed.

A thirty nine-year-old female with progressive systemic sclerosis was admitted to our hospital. She complained of Raynaud's phenomenon and had a severe headache. While trying to induce digital vasospasm with cold pressor stimulation, we simultaneously measured each areas of the artery and vein from the first branch to the second branch of the fundus with a PC-8801-MARK II Digitizer. The artery of the fundus dilates in patients with headaches. This suggests that Raynaud's phenomenon is associated with cerebral artery changes.

A 73-year-old male complaining of dysphagia was admitted to our hospital and diagnosed by endoscopy as having esophageal carcinoma at the middle intra-thoracic esophagus. The presence of metastatic lymph node swelling at the bifurcation of the trachea caused renal and respiratory dysfunctions. Combination therapy with 1200 ng/body/day 5'-DFUR (5'-deoxy-fluorouridine) for about 7 months, irradiation with a total dose of 61.2 Gy, and hyperthermia, for 40 minutes once per week for 6 times was selected for treatment. With this combination therapy, complete response was obtained 10 months after beginning the treatment, which continued for 10 more months. Effectiveness of this therapy on the metastatic lymph nodes at the bifurcation was observed by CT scan. Thus, this combination therapy is recommended for patients with inoperable esophageal carcinoma.
